CAN YOU PLUG LASER PRINTER TO THE UPS?

It depends on how big the UPS is. A laser printer is going to draw roughly 600 to 1200 watts, depending on how large it is. Most people DON'T plug them into the UPS; if you lose power it's pretty easy to clear any jam and wait until the lights come back on.

What are power upz?

First, I think there is a mistake here, there is not UPZ, but UPS, which means UNINTERRUPTIBLE POWER SUPPLY. They are devices that are usually installed so the electrical energy goes from the main socket to an electrical or elecronical device thru them, so you plug in the UPS and then you plug for example your computer into the UPS, the latter having one or several sockets. The idea is that if there is an interruption in the supply of energy from the main source, the UPS acts like a battery that allows you, for exaple, if you use it for a computer to save your work before you turn it off in a case like this.
